Growing point
Meristems at the tips of roots and stems of higher plants. In higher plants, the locations of cell division are limited to the growing point and cambium. Cell division occurs actively at the growing point, while cell elongation and differentiation occur a short distance away. Growing points are also found in adventitious buds and roots. Furthermore, the growing points of roots are usually covered by root caps, and the growing points of stems are usually covered by young leaves. → Roots/buds → Related topic: Stems
